Bob Jarmain was sentenced yesterday.  It didn't turn out as well as we were
hoping, but better than nothing.
 
Bob is now banned from owning any animals for 2 years, which, considering
he is 82, could be the rest of his life.  Lara T tells me that he has 30
days to get rid of all the animals on his property and then the Humane
Society can come and take the rest.  He has no ferrets currently.
 
The London Humane Society tried for a ban for 5 years, but under the
Canadian Criminal Code, 2 years is the maximum.
 
Currently, our Minister of Justice is hearing arguments on making the
C.C.C.  tougher for animal offenders.  Hopefully, this will come about
